Wādī Banī Khālid (Arabic: وَادِي بَنِي خَالِد) is a wadi and a tourist attraction in Oman.
[1] Its stream maintains a constant flow of water throughout the year.
Large pools of water and boulders are scattered along the course of the wadi.
As a geographical area, the wadi covers a large swathe of lowland and the Hajar Mountains.
